I think the SuperTeddyReg based supplies have come out as some of the best but I'm not sure if anyone has compared one of them against something like a Paul Hynes. Both Paul and Teddy make exceptionally good supplies but even something like a Maplin linear supply will probably provide better results than the standard smps. Saying that, upgrading the regulators to Murata or NewClassD versions makes a big difference when paired with a linear supply. The two mods just seem to compliment each other. I'd say the regs and linear supply will provide quite a big improvement. The other mods such as caps around the DAC chip usually produce a much smaller improvement.
